A detailed understanding of the distribution and potential of natural gas hydrate(NGHs)resources is crucial to fostering the industrialization of those resources in the South China Sea,where NGHs are abundant.In this study,this study analyzed the applicability of resource evaluation methods,including the volumetric,genesis,and analogy methods,and estimated NGHs resource potential in the South China Sea by using scientific resource evaluation methods based on the factors controlling the geological accumulation and the reservoir characteristics of NGHs.Furthermore,this study compared the evaluation results of NGHs resource evaluations in representative worldwise sea areas via rational analysis.The results of this study are as follows:(1)The gas hydrate accumulation in the South China Sea is characterized by multiple sources of gas supply,multi-channel migration,and extensive accumulation,which are significantly different from those of oil and gas and other unconventional resources.(2)The evaluation of gas hydrate resources in the South China Sea is a highly targeted,stratified,and multidisciplinary evaluation of geological resources under the framework of a multi-type gas hydrate resource evaluation system and focuses on the comprehensive utilization of multi-source heterogeneous data.(3)Global NGHs resources is n×10^(15)m^(3),while the NGHs resources in the South China Sea are estimated to be 10^(13)m^(3),which is comparable to the abundance of typical marine NGHs deposits in other parts of the world.In the South China Sea,the NGHs resources have a broad prospect and provide a substantial resource base for production tests and industrialization of NGHs. 展开更多

The Qilian Mountain permafrost area located in the northern of Qinghai-Tibet Plateau is a favorable place for natural gas hydrate formation and enrichment,due to its well-developed fractures and abundant gas sources.Understanding the formation and distribution of multi-component gas hydrates in fractures is crucial in accurately evaluating the hydrate reservoir resources in this area.The hydrate formation experiments were carried out using the core samples drilled from hydrate-bearing sediments in Qilian Mountain permafrost area and the multi-component gas with similar composition to natural gas hydrates in Qilian Mountain permafrost area.The formation and distribution characteristics of multi-component gas hydrates in core samples were observed in situ by X-ray Computed Tomography(X-CT)under high pressure and low temperature conditions.Results show that hydrates are mainly formed and distributed in the fractures with good connectivity.The ratios of volume of hydrates formed in fractures to the volume of fractures are about 96.8%and 60.67%in two different core samples.This indicates that the fracture surface may act as a favorable reaction site for hydrate formation in core samples.Based on the field geological data and the experimental results,it is preliminarily estimated that the inventory of methane stored in the fractured gas hydrate in Qilian Mountain permafrost area is about 8.67×1013 m3,with a resource abundance of 8.67×108 m3/km2.This study demonstrates the great resource potential of fractured gas hydrate and also provides a new way to further understand the prospect of natural gas hydrate and other oil and gas resources in Qilian Mountain permafrost area. 展开更多

The issue of China's energy supply security is not only the key problem which af- fects China's rapid and sustainable development in the 21st century, but also the one which international attention focuses on. Based on the notable characteristic of spatial imbalance between energy production and consumption in China, this paper takes the evolution of China's primary energy resources development(excluding hydropower) from 1949 to 2007 as the study object, with the aim to sum up the evolutive characteristics and laws of China's energy resources development in the past nearly 60 years. Then, based on comprehensive considerations of coal's, oil's and natural gas's basic reserves, qualities, geological conditions production status, and ecological service function of every province, this paper adopts development potential index (DP)to evaluate the development potential of every province's en- ergy resources, and divide them into different ranks. Conclusions are drawn as follows: (1) Generally speaking, China's gross energy production was increasing in waves from 1949 to 2007. From the viewpoint of spatial patterns, China's energy resources development has shown a characteristic of "concentrating to the north and central areas, and evolving from linear-shaped to "T-shaped" pattern gradually since 1949. (2) The structure evolution of China's energy resources development in general has shown a trend of "coal proportion is dominant but decreasing, while oil and gas proportions are increasing" since 1949. (3) At the provincial scale, China's energy resources development potential could be divided into large, sub-large, general and small ranks, four in all. In the future, the spatial pattern of China's energy production will evolve from "T-shaped" to "R-shaped pattern". These conclusions will help to clarify the temporal and spatial characteristics and laws of China's energy resources development, and will be beneficial for China to design scientific and rational energy development strategies and plans, coordinate spatial imbalance of energy production and consumption, ensure national energy supply, avoid energy resources waste and disorderly development, and promote regional sustainable development under the globalization back-ground with changeful international energy market. 展开更多

To further explore characteristics of tourist resources in Liuchong and Longtan Scenic spots in Longtan National Forest Park,Classification,Investigation and Evaluation of Tourist Resources(GB/T18972-2003) and Quality Grading of Scenic Resources in Forest Parks of China(GB/T18005-1999) were adopted to analyze composition and distribution features of tourist resources in Liuchong and Longtan Scenic Spots,qualitative evaluation of scenic resources in the 2 study scenic spots,quantitative evaluation of resource units and quality evaluation of tourist resources were respectively carried out.The results showed that the park has diversified tourist resources such as peaks,valleys,cliffs,brooks,waterfalls and forests,as well as rich animal and plant species and an excellent natural eco-environment;5 Grade-IV tourist landscapes,6 Grade-III tourist landscapes,14 Grade-II ones,4 Grade-I ones;quality of tourist resources was scored as 41.3,up to the scenic resource standards of Grade-I Forest Park. 展开更多

Sanjiang Plain of Heilongjiang Province has become an important commodity grain base in our country after the construction of more than a century. Groundwater is the main water source for industrial and agricultural production and daily life in the area. With the large-scale development and construction in this area, there are a series of ecological and environmental geological problems, such as the reduction of groundwater resources, which seriously restricts the sustainable development of local agriculture and society as well as economy. Based on the characteristics of three-dimensional flowof groundwater in Sanjiang Plain, this paper adopts the simulation software Visual MODFLOW to evaluate groundwater exploitation potential. The results show that overall there is a certain exploitation potential of Sanjiang Plain groundwater but it is unevenly distributed, and overdraft phenomenon exists in seven farms such as Baoquanling and Chuangye. Based on analytic hierarchy process, the evaluation result of eco-geological environment quality in Sanjiang Plain shows that 94.5% of the region features good geological environment quality, medium stability and medium bearing capacity. The study can provide geological evidence for optimal allocation of water resources, land planning and regulation, and the high and stable yield of the commodity grain base in Sanjiang Plain. 展开更多

回灌是保障地热资源可持续开发利用的关键手段,而采灌均衡条件下地热资源潜力评价方法研究对地热资源的可持续开发利用具有重要意义。本文通过引入热突破和考虑回灌条件下单井开采权益保护半径的概念,提出了回灌条件下地热资源可开采量... 回灌是保障地热资源可持续开发利用的关键手段,而采灌均衡条件下地热资源潜力评价方法研究对地热资源的可持续开发利用具有重要意义。本文通过引入热突破和考虑回灌条件下单井开采权益保护半径的概念,提出了回灌条件下地热资源可开采量的评价方法,并以雄安新区雾迷山组碳酸盐岩热储层为例,分别计算了未考虑回灌条件和考虑回灌条件下的地热流体可开采量、可开采热量及折合标煤量。结果显示采用开采系数法计算的未考虑回灌条件下的可开采量要远小于考虑回灌条件下的可开采量;考虑回灌条件下三种方法的结果对比为:热突破法>考虑回灌条件下单井开采权益保护半径(消耗15%)>考虑回灌条件下单井开采权益保护半径(热储温度下降2℃),考虑地热资源的可持续性以及对热储环境严格保护要求,按照考虑回灌条件下单井开采权益保护半径方法计算的雄安新区雾迷山组热储地热开采量更为适宜。目前全国各地陆续出台相关政策要求实施地热回灌,该方法的提出为科学评价各地回灌条件下的地热可开采量提供了技术支撑。 展开更多

在分析南美油气地质特征的基础上,进行南美主要含油气盆地待发现常规油气资源评价,总结待发现油气资源分布规律,探讨其勘探前景。结果表明,受4大板块碰撞影响,南美沉积盆地可分成弧前、弧后、前陆、内克拉通和被动陆缘盆地5种类型。南... 在分析南美油气地质特征的基础上,进行南美主要含油气盆地待发现常规油气资源评价,总结待发现油气资源分布规律,探讨其勘探前景。结果表明,受4大板块碰撞影响,南美沉积盆地可分成弧前、弧后、前陆、内克拉通和被动陆缘盆地5种类型。南美油气成藏条件优越,烃源岩以中新生界海相-陆相泥岩为主,生烃潜力大。储层以白垩系和第三系碎屑岩和碳酸盐岩为主,分布广泛。盖层中新生界区域性泥岩和盐岩为主,封堵能力强。采用以成藏组合为基础评价单元的资源评价方法,将南美65个盆地共划分出152个成藏组合,并进行了资源评价。预测南美65个主要含油气盆地的待发现石油可采资源量为263 716 MMB,待发现凝析油可采资源量为7 405 MMB,待发现天然气可采资源量为559 020 BCF。待发现油气资源在平面上呈“两带”展布、“两中心”富集特征;在纵向上主要富集于白垩系和第三系。被动陆缘盆地和前陆盆地是南美未来油气勘探的两个重点领域,其中深海和前陆冲断带是主要勘探方向,巴西、委内瑞拉是重点关注国家。 展开更多

针对武清凹陷沙河街组三段烃源岩分布特征、生排烃潜力认识不清等问题,以全油气系统理论为指导,基于研究区岩心、测井、实测地化等资料,建立了武清凹陷沙三段烃源岩的生排烃模式,明确了研究区的烃源岩分布和地球化学特征,以及源内生、... 针对武清凹陷沙河街组三段烃源岩分布特征、生排烃潜力认识不清等问题,以全油气系统理论为指导,基于研究区岩心、测井、实测地化等资料,建立了武清凹陷沙三段烃源岩的生排烃模式,明确了研究区的烃源岩分布和地球化学特征,以及源内生、排、残留烃量特征。结果表明:1)武清凹陷沙三段烃源岩厚度大,有机质丰度高,母质类型较好,处于低熟—成熟阶段,且与多个构造带有良好的油源匹配关系;2)武清凹陷沙三段烃源岩总生烃量为4950×10^(8)t,总排烃量为3170×10^(8)t,残留烃量为1780×10^(8)t,生烃潜力较大;3)基于全油气系统理论计算的结果不仅包含生烃量,还包含排烃量(常规+致密烃量)及残留烃量(页岩烃量)。该研究对于沙三段深层油气勘探具有指导意义。 展开更多

四川盆地是中国最具勘探潜力的非常规油气盆地之一,其中川东北地区的大安寨段地层发育富含机质并与薄层介壳灰岩互层的页岩,有生烃、含油含气的特征,具有页岩油气开发潜力。为明确四川盆地川东北地区大安寨段页岩储层的油气资源潜力,综... 四川盆地是中国最具勘探潜力的非常规油气盆地之一,其中川东北地区的大安寨段地层发育富含机质并与薄层介壳灰岩互层的页岩,有生烃、含油含气的特征,具有页岩油气开发潜力。为明确四川盆地川东北地区大安寨段页岩储层的油气资源潜力,综合运用油气地球化学和地质学研究方法,对该地区的页岩油和页岩气的资源潜力进行评价,预测页岩油气的有利区。结果表明:大安寨段岩性主要为黑色页岩和介壳灰岩。其中,大二亚段为富含有机质的页岩层段;大安寨段累计厚度约为60~110m,埋藏深度约为1000~3600m;有机质类型以Ⅱ2型为主,有机碳含量介于0.42%~2.74%,平均值为1.18%;有机质成熟度为0.94%~1.84%,主要处于成熟—高成熟阶段;大安寨段页岩埋藏深度适中,有效厚度大,生烃潜力高,具备页岩油气成藏的基础条件;大安寨段页岩气和页岩油的有利区位于研究区西南部和东部,估算页岩气资源量为24543×10^(8)m^(3),页岩油资源量为10×10^(4)t。根据研究结果,分别优选研究区的页岩油气的Ⅰ类有利区带和Ⅱ类有利区带,可为大安寨段页岩油气勘探开发提供参考。 展开更多

潼关县是重要的黄金采、选、冶、加工工业区之一,地处秦岭、黄河及渭河阶地地带,以往该地区地下水资源勘查评价不系统,且具有局部性,该地区矿产资源的开发导致可再生的地下水资源未得到合理的开发利用,局部地区的不合理开采引发了地下... 潼关县是重要的黄金采、选、冶、加工工业区之一,地处秦岭、黄河及渭河阶地地带,以往该地区地下水资源勘查评价不系统,且具有局部性,该地区矿产资源的开发导致可再生的地下水资源未得到合理的开发利用,局部地区的不合理开采引发了地下水位下降、水环境污染、生态环境恶化等问题。在系统分析整理前人研究成果的基础上,对研究区采用水文地质及开采现状调查、地面物探、抽水试验及水质化验等手段,获得比较系统、科学、全面技术资料,计算相关水文地质参数、水资源量及开采潜力等。经计算,研究区地下水天然资源补给量127774.45 m^(3)/d,储存量4434806024.0 m^(3),天然可开采资源量为87414.80 m^(3)/d,剩余开采资源量33464.12 m^(3)/d。经评价该区地下水可开采量及开发潜力为中等地区,并提出开发利用建议。 展开更多
